Kassa Overall Announces New Album, Animals
The prolific Brooklyn drummer/producer’s Warp Records debut due out May 26th

Seattle-born, Brooklyn-based drummer, singer, emcee and producer Kassa Overall has announced his new album, Animals, which comes out May 26 via Warp Records.
The LP features a super stacked guest list, with contributions from Danny Brown, Shabazz Palaces, Vijay Iyer, Wiki, Laura Mvula, Lil B, Francis and the Lights, Nick Hakim and Theo Croker.
“We call ourselves humans, right,” Overall said in a press statement. “But we kind of do animalistic shit towards each other. We justify immorality by almost stripping people of their humanity. He’s an animal, so we can treat him as such. All these different kinds of little questions in these songs point to questions about humanity: Am I free? Or am I a circus animal? These questions intersect with the way I think about race.”
With Animals, his Warp Records debut, Overall uses music to push the message, utilizing layers of Roland 808 breaks against avant-garde drumming in the vein of his mentors Elvin Jones and Billy Hart, the latter of whom he studied with at the Oberlin Conservatory of Music. Improvisational jazz maneuvering, meanwhile, weaves in and out of orchestral string arrangements by Jherek Bischoff.
